Nicknamed “The Gaelic café” by locals, An Taigh Cèilidh is a Gaelic community centre with events, café, bookshop & gifts. The use of Gaelic is encouraged, though everyone is welcome regardless of whether fluent or don’t have a single word.

Download the Uist Unearthed app and reveal an impressive Viking longhouse, which dominated the Bornais machair 1100 years ago.

Taigh Chearsabhagh Museum and Arts Centre in Lochmaddy on the island of North Uist is the hub for the history, arts, culture and language of the island.

Scarista House, a former Georgian manse, is a comfortable, elegant small hotel on the west coast of the Isle of Harris with lovely views of the Atlantic ocean, heather-covered mountains, and a beautiful three-mile long shell sand beach.
